Robert Brooks's books
3.98 avg rating — 2,984 ratings 4.13 avg rating — 1,467 ratings 4.04 avg rating — 603 ratings 4.10 avg rating — 431 ratings 3.92 avg rating — 380 ratings 4.12 avg rating — 225 ratings 4.07 avg rating — 182 ratings 4.16 avg rating — 136 ratings 4.13 avg rating — 108 ratings 3.76 avg rating — 98 ratings